Trump Says He’s Worried He Won’t Get Into Heaven

President Donald Trump recently made striking remarks during an appearance on Fox & Friends, where he reflected on both his personal faith and his role in international politics. Trump admitted that he sometimes worries he may not “get to Heaven,” claiming that some people have even told him he is “at the bottom of the totem pole” when it comes to worthiness. These comments offered a rare moment of vulnerability, as Trump is typically known for projecting confidence and certainty.

He connected these personal concerns to his broader political mission, suggesting that his efforts to bring peace to conflict zones could be a way of redeeming himself. Specifically, he mentioned his push for peace in Ukraine, as well as efforts to reduce tensions between India and Pakistan. Trump framed these initiatives not only as matters of foreign policy but also as deeply moral undertakings, emphasizing that saving lives by preventing wars might be his ultimate path “to Heaven.”

The timing of his remarks followed a significant White House meeting with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ky and several European leaders. The gathering focused on the ongoing war in Ukraine and possible steps toward achieving a negotiated peace. By hosting these discussions, Trump aimed to position the United States as a central mediator in one of the most critical conflicts in the world.

In addition to speaking with Zelensky, Trump revealed that he had also been in contact with Russian President Vladimir Putin. He stated that these conversations were part of a broader attempt to establish conditions for meaningful peace talks. Although skepticism remains about the feasibility of such negotiations, the fact that direct dialogue is being encouraged marked a noteworthy development.

European leaders who participated in the White House meeting expressed cautious optimism. They praised the progress made during the discussions, describing it as the most significant movement toward resolving the conflict in years. This reaction highlighted the importance of diplomatic engagement and suggested that even small steps forward could build momentum toward a broader resolution.
